The Dangers of Drowsy Driving
Drowsy driving is much more of a threat than most people realize. In fact, the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) estimates that one out of every 25 adults have fallen asleep while driving in the past month. The Importance of Accounting for Blind Spots
Blind spots, as most careful drivers are aware, are zones to the side and rear of a car where approaching vehicles are not visible to the driver, even when using a rear view or side mirror.
